I bought my Delta 4000 (first metal detector) from academy sports, I want to upgrade to a 10" coil, everything I see online has a screw in connector, mine has a push in connector. E-mailed First Texas and they said I had the older model and would have to buy a push in connector coil. Does anyone know where I can find one?

Since you already have a concentric coil, your most sensible upgrade would be the 11 inch DD. It'll deliver more in-the-ground horsepower but you may still use the original 8 inch concentric for sites with a lot of steel bottlecaps. When ordering, make sure you get the right one-- it's the coil that was originally developed as an accessory for the Fisher F5, with the push-on connector, what the factory calls a "B-plug".
